2. What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files stored on your device (computer, tablet, or mobile device) when you visit a website.
Cookies allow websites to remember information about your visit, such as your preferences, language settings, and browsing behavior.
Cookies help websites:
Function properly
Improve user experience
Understand visitor behavior
Provide relevant content and services
Cookies do not normally contain information that directly identifies you, but certain information collected through cookies may be associated with personal information you provide.

5. How Long Do Cookies Stay on Your Device?
Cookies may remain on your device for different periods depending on their purpose.
They may be:
Session Cookies
These cookies are deleted automatically when you close your browser.
Persistent Cookies
These cookies remain on your device for a specific period or until you manually delete them.
